I hope this finds you well and enjoying the holiday season.  Our working party has been active this year with a strong presence at the 2019 IUFRO World Congress where we helped support plenary, technical, and poster sessions and a side event of forest landscape restoration.  You can find the technical presentations on this Google Drive. The events were all well attended with much discussion.  Those of us fortunate to attend the World Congress in Curitiba, Brazil, enjoyed the opportunity to learn from one another and create and strengthen networks.

 

After serving 9 years as the working party coordinator, it is time for me to step down. The attached activity report describes our work together this past decade. I have very much enjoyed helping with these  activities and especially meeting many of you and sharing experiences across the globe.

 

I am happy to announce that Ewa Hermanowicz, Communication Officer with the European Forest Genetic Resource Programme, will be the new coordinator for the Communications and Public Relations Working Party.  She brings a wealth of knowledge and experience that will serve the working party well.  I look forward to Ewa leading the working party toward a bright future of innovation and networking.
